The Long of the Short Story
A lot has been said and written about the art of writing the short story. Many authors started out this way, while others return to the genre and have made it their specialty. The short story has gained prominence in the canon of African literature, attested to by the growth in the number of literary prizes now available. In this panel, Toni Kan will question Chika Unigwe, Jennifer Makumbi and Billy Kahora on writing short fiction, and the prospects for publishing.
